Completed

Desenvolvimento de Podcast player para Ios

Published on the February 21, 2016 in IT & Programming

About this project

Open

Bom dia!
Temos o projeto de um app de PodCast para iOS (iPhones e iPads), que futuramente iremos expandir para Android também.
O app é apenas para usuários registrados. Ele será formado das seguintes telas:
- Tela inicial de login: permitindo ao usuário entrar com email e senha. Deve ter botões também para duas telas/popups: Primeiro acesso, onde ele deve entrar com email, CPF e cadastrar uma nova senha; e Esqueci a Senha, onde ele deve entrar com seu email, e receberá via email um link para cadastrar uma nova senha;
- Tela Principal: formada por uma lista de podcasts/áudios, que ele pode escolher para ouvir.
Cada podcast terá uma cor diferente, em função se o usuário já ouviu, ou se o áudio é novo. Deve ter também um sidemenu, podendo acessar toda a lista de podcasts, apenas os novos (não ouvidos) e selecionar por categoria;
- Tela do player: ao selecionar um áudio, o usuário vai para o player. Nela ele pode ver o título e descrição do podcast, e baixar o áudio.
Assim que baixar ele pode ouvi-lo, e deve ter os controles (tocar, pausar, parar, volume e posição no áudio);
- Tela de perguntas e avaliação: ao terminar de ouvir, cada podcast pode ter uma ou mais perguntas, para avaliar se o usuário realmente ouviu e entendeu o conteúdo do podcast. Ao terminar as perguntas, deve abrir um popup para que ele avalie se gostou do áudio, de 1 a 5 estrelas.

Todas as informações dos usuários, podcasts, bem como as ações do usuário no app devem ser lidas e salvas através de uma API do Azure Mobile Services, e o ideal é utilizar o Framework para XCode. O Framework permite ainda usar o CoreData para offline sync das informações, permitindo usar o app mesmo sem acesso à Internet.

Temos o prazo de desenvolvimento e testes do app até final de março, então o início é imediato. Na sequência, temos interesse em desenvolver o mesmo app para Android também.

O app deve ser nativo, de preferência em Swift, e deve ser compatível com iOS 8.x e 9.x.
O layout e design do app já está feito, será fornecido no início do projeto.

Quaisquer dúvidas, ou se precisar de mais informações, mande msg.

Category IT & Programming
Subcategory Apps programming. Android, iOS and others
Is this a project or a position? Project
I currently have I have specifications
Required availability As needed
Experience in this type of projects Yes (I have managed this kind of project before)
API Integrations Other (Other APIs)
Required platforms iPhone, iPad

Delivery term: Not specified

Skills needed

Other projects posted by R. Z.